I read somewhere that these are aimed at the high end DVd consumer (most of us here) so if you want good first week sales you might want to put them off a few weeks.
If they are indeed coming out Oct. 9, then a lot of us will have our DVD money going to the hefty Godfather set that week.
I think Superbit is a great idea and want to get it, but I won't repurchase a movie before getting one of the holy trilogies (SW, Indy, Godfather is the holy trilogy of holy trilogies).
And I don't know about others, but if I miss the first week discounts, sometimes my interest wanes quickly (especially on repurchases).
Just a suggestion.

I would have to agree. This superbit idea would seem better suited to filling in the schedule lull we see in the 1st and 2nd quarters of every year.
It doesn't make sense to me to try this Superbit idea in the middle of October, which is currently the busiest month of the year and has many long awaited titles.
I'll be picking up a few of these SuperBits, but maybe not until early next year.
